This is a somewhat interesting villain with yet another mechanic that none of the others possess. He will generate targets that will take action against you, but he will attack them and absorb them if allowed to destroy them. As a result, you have to juggle between keeping him starved while chipping away at his HP.

In terms of strategy, Cypher is here for nemesis reasons. He is a support hero, so I want to bring members of Renegade who can supply the DPS that this version of him cannot. You have a minimum of 1 augment per hero, and once everyone has been upgraded, your one-shots start offering game changing effects. Make sure to guard your gear.

As for the Renegades, I brought Cricket on the hopes she could protect the team on a rough turn. Gyro, Impact, and Quicksilver all have the potential to deal some serious damage though, so they are the ones I want to hurry up and augment. There are a few different ways to use Quicksilver here, where I can give her additional card plays or mitigate some damage so she can do a very long combo. As for the others, they are fairly self explanatory.

In terms of environment, I think this one is shaping up to be my favorite of the expansion. There are opportunities for good luck from the environment and there is still the potential for things to go wrong. It keeps you on your feet, and you have the means to influence it by timing your environment destruction correctly. Alternatively, you can bring heroes to control it for you, so keep in mind you have loads of options.
